What are Compostable Containers?

Compostable containers are made from organic materials such as cornstarch, bamboo, and sugarcane. Unlike their non-compostable counterparts, these containers can be broken down into natural elements through composting, which means they won't sit in landfills for hundreds of years. Where to Find Compostable Containers

Compostable containers are becoming more widely available as the demand for sustainable packaging options increases. Many grocery stores, restaurants, and food delivery services are now using compostable containers. You can also purchase them online from various retailers.
